失眠网,内容丰富有趣,生活中的好帮手!
失眠网 > C语言编写九九乘法表 实现不同三角形形状表格输出

C语言编写九九乘法表 实现不同三角形形状表格输出

时间:2021-09-05 17:20:39

相关推荐

C语言编写九九乘法表 实现不同三角形形状表格输出

主要是用for循环来写九九乘法表

1.左下角

#include <stdio.h>int main(){int i, j;for (i = 1; i < 10; i++){for (j = 1; j <= i; j++){printf("%d*%d=%-3d ", j, i, i * j);}printf("\n");}return 0;}

2.等腰三角形

#include <stdio.h>int main(){int a = 0, b = 0, c = 0;for (a = 9; a >= 1; a--){for (c = 0; c <= (8 - a) * 4; c++){printf(" ");}for (b = 1; b <= a; b++)printf("%d*%d=%2d ", a, b, a * b);printf("\n\n");}return 0;}

3.左上角

#include <stdio.h>int main(){int i = 0, j = 0;for (i = 9; i >= 1; i--){for (j = 1; j <= i; j++)printf("%d*%d=%-3d ", i, j, i * j);printf("\n");}return 0;}

4.右上角

#include <stdio.h>int main(){int i, j;for (i = 9; i > 0; i--){for (j = 9; j > 0; j--){if (i < j)printf("\t");elseprintf("%d*%d=%2d ", j, i, i * j);}printf("\n");}return 0;}

5.右下角

#include <stdio.h>int main(){int i = 0, j = 0;for (i = 1; i < 10; i++){for (j = 9; j > 0; j--){if (i >= j)printf("%d*%d=%-3d ", i, j, i * j);elseprintf("\t");}printf("\n");}return 0;}

如果觉得《C语言编写九九乘法表 实现不同三角形形状表格输出》对你有帮助,请点赞、收藏,并留下你的观点哦!

本内容不代表本网观点和政治立场,如有侵犯你的权益请联系我们处理。
网友评论
网友评论仅供其表达个人看法,并不表明网站立场。